#e2b1d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2b1d4 is composed of 88.6% red, 69.4%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.7% magenta, 6.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 317.1 degrees, a saturation of 45.8% and a lightness of 79%. #e2b1d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c563a9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#e2b1d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2b1d4 has RGB values of R:226, G:177,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.06,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14856660.
